2020 TESLA MODEL 3- williamsburg, VA
In Jan, 2026, the front suspension in the 2020 Model 3 started making a cracking, catching, grinding and/or popping noise as I turned the steering column while parked or driving slowly. When investigating, it sounded like it was coming from bearings in the front suspension. It continued to get worse, making the catching / grinding / popping noise when driving on the highway, turning or not turning, to the point that it felt like the suspension would completely tear apart, and I took the vehicle in for service in early March. Telsa service ended up replacing the left and right upper control arm assembly, the front left and right lower compliance link and the lower lateral links. Online research on various tesla forums showed this to be a known problem with vehicle owners. Unsure if continuing with the issue prior to service would have caused a safety concren, but it was beyond the point of sounding safe to operate to me.

2020 TESLA MODEL 3- SANTA BARBARA, CA
I was making a right turn from the parking lot onto the street, a maneuver I have made hundreds of times previously without any issue. My foot was on the accelerator pedal as normal for this turn. The vehicle accelerated far faster than intended for this maneuver, with tires screeching, and continued across the width of the street. The vehicle's front left wheel struck the curb on the opposite side of the street from the parking lot exit. The wheel sustained significant damage, and the wheel rim was torn. When I regained my bearings, I lifted my foot off the accelerator and the vehicle slowed down. At the time, I believed a serious crash was imminent. I was able to drive the vehicle home, which was about 1 1/2 miles away, but it is not safe to drive so I won't drive it until it is repaired. I am aware that Tesla and NHTSA have attributed many prior sudden acceleration incidents to drivers unintentionally pressing the accelerator when intending to press the brake. Due to the vehicle's regenerative braking, I rarely use the brake pedal during normal driving, which makes this explanation virtually impossible in my case. I am also aware that NHTSA reopened an investigation in 2023 after learning about a potential inverter-related design flaw that could cause sudden unintended acceleration in Tesla vehicles, and that this investigation remains open as of this writing.

2020 TESLA MODEL 3- Malden, MA
On XXX, at approximately 2:47:42 PM, I was driving a 2020 Tesla Model 3 Long Range AWD VIN [XXX] on a two-lane road in the Adirondacks with Full Self-Driving (Supervised) active. The vehicle was traveling approximately 50–52 mph. An oncoming SUV moved toward or across the double-yellow centerline while passing a bicyclist. FSD reacted with a sudden and aggressive steering maneuver to the right. The vehicle crossed the white edge line and entered the paved shoulder. Because it appeared that the vehicle might leave the roadway, I immediately took control and steered it back toward the travel lane. The vehicle then oscillated sharply in both directions before stabilizing. External telemetry shows lateral acceleration reaching approximately 0.88 g in one direction and 0.84 g in the opposite direction, with a 1.72 g peak-to-peak lateral swing. Vehicle speed fell from approximately 50 mph to approximately 28 mph during the recovery. No collision or injury occurred. The rapid deceleration and stabilization appeared consistent with possible electronic stability-control intervention, but I cannot confirm that from the available external telemetry. I have preserved the front dashcam video and telemetry file. I request that Tesla preserve and review the internal vehicle logs, including FSD commanded steering, planned path, driver steering torque, road-edge perception, oncoming-vehicle perception, stability-control activation, individual-wheel braking, and motor-torque reduction. 2020 TESLA MODEL 3- El Paso, TX
On July 11 at approximately 6:47 a.m., I was operating my Tesla Model 3 on Interstate 65 in Hart County, Kentucky, with Full Self-Driving (FSD) engaged during normal highway travel. Approximately one hour earlier, I had departed a highway rest area after sleeping from the previous day’s travel. Rain developed during the trip, but I observed adequate visibility, apparent roadway traction, and I was not impaired. I was traveling in the far-right lane of a three-lane interstate. The posted speed limit was approximately 70 mph; however, FSD limited the vehicle to approximately 65 mph and displayed warnings indicating that the higher speed was unavailable. While FSD remained engaged, the system initiated a lane change from the far-right lane into the center lane. After entering the center lane, the vehicle began displaying repeated warning messages and FSD disengaged multiple times. I attempted to locate settings related to the warnings on the touchscreen but could not identify an available adjustment. During the third disengagement, I perceived that the vehicle continued braking without releasing while steering resistance increased significantly. The steering wheel then rotated abruptly, and I was unable to regain normal directional control before the vehicle departed its intended travel path and struck a concrete median. The collision caused personal injuries and substantial vehicle damage. I have not been able to reproduce the condition. The incident was investigated by the Kentucky State Police. Based on the sequence of repeated FSD warnings, disengagements, continued braking, and abrupt steering behavior, I believe this event warrants investigation. I request that NHTSA review the vehicle’s Full Self-Driving logs, telemetry, Event Data Recorder (EDR) data, steering and braking commands, diagnostic records, and software history to determine whether a vehicle or software malfunction contributed to the collision. 2020 TESLA MODEL 3- Richmond, VA
The wiring in my trunk harness was severed due to the repeated opening and closing of my trunk. This caused my reverse lights to fail and my trunk latch to stop working. This issue is part of a known recall: Campaign 21V-00D. Tesla attempted to fix the issue in 2023 but the poor repair did not work. I took my Tesla to the dealer and they refused to remedy the issue unless I would pay $1300. I persuaded them to lower the feet to $300 but still feel that I should not pay anything because this issue was due to the recall.
